Transaction 58d53895885449e93289e57f3f7ac90bbe190a0bba093e0f27f1d006a6ef66b1
1 Input
1 Output
-
58d53895885449e93289e57f3f7ac90bbe190a0bba093e0f27f1d006a6ef66b1:0
- value
- 19490951
- script pubkey
- OP_0 OP_PUSHBYTES_20 e37563aac96d7625d705da1c49a88e7cef0efc28
- address
- bc1qud6k82kfd4mzt4c9mgwyn2yw0nhsalpg6jeu8z